Area code 272 is a geographic code serving Williamsport, Pennsylvania in the Eastern time zone. It has been in service since October 21, 2013. The same territory is also served by its overlay code (272/570 complex). Keep in mind the code identifies where the number was registered; the person calling may be elsewhere.

The code currently holds 320 working prefixes, held by 38 different carriers. Of these, 320 are pooled prefixes shared by multiple carriers. Numbers are anchored to 131 rate centers — billing localities that fix where each prefix belongs.

The code was carved out of 570 (2013).

The current NANPA exhaust forecast for the 272/570 complex is 1Q 2038.

Local calls inside 272 are dialed 10D; 1+10 digit dialing for all hnpa and fnpa calls permissible at service provider discretion.

FAQ

Where is a 272 number from?

272 is assigned to Williamsport and surrounding areas of Pennsylvania in the Eastern time zone. The three digits after the area code (the prefix) narrow it down to a rate center.

Is 272 a toll-free number?

No. 272 is a geographic code; calls are billed like any other domestic call. Toll-free codes are 800, 833, 844, 855, 866, 877 and 888.

Why do 570 and 272 cover the same place?

They are overlays: when a code runs low on numbers, a new code is added over the same territory instead of splitting it. The 272/570 complex shares one service area, and local calls are dialed with 10 digits.
